Subject: [PATCH v2 1/6] mhi: pci_generic: Parametrable element count for events
Date: Fri,  5 Mar 2021 13:47:53 +0100	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<1614948478-2284-1-git-send-email-loic.poulain@linaro.org> (raw)

Not all hardwares need to use the same number of event ring elements.
This change makes this parametrable.

Signed-off-by: Loic Poulain <loic.poulain@linaro.org>
Reviewed-by: Manivannan Sadhasivam <manivannan.sadhasivam@linaro.org>
---
 v2: no change

 drivers/bus/mhi/pci_generic.c | 20 ++++++++++----------
 1 file changed, 10 insertions(+), 10 deletions(-)

diff --git a/drivers/bus/mhi/pci_generic.c b/drivers/bus/mhi/pci_generic.c
index 8187fcf..c58bf96 100644
--- a/drivers/bus/mhi/pci_generic.c
+++ b/drivers/bus/mhi/pci_generic.c
@@ -71,9 +71,9 @@ struct mhi_pci_dev_info {
 		.doorbell_mode_switch = false,		\
 	}
 
-#define MHI_EVENT_CONFIG_CTRL(ev_ring)		\
+#define MHI_EVENT_CONFIG_CTRL(ev_ring, el_count) \
 	{					\
-		.num_elements = 64,		\
+		.num_elements = el_count,	\
 		.irq_moderation_ms = 0,		\
 		.irq = (ev_ring) + 1,		\
 		.priority = 1,			\
@@ -114,9 +114,9 @@ struct mhi_pci_dev_info {
 		.doorbell_mode_switch = true,		\
 	}
 
-#define MHI_EVENT_CONFIG_DATA(ev_ring)		\
+#define MHI_EVENT_CONFIG_DATA(ev_ring, el_count) \
 	{					\
-		.num_elements = 128,		\
+		.num_elements = el_count,	\
 		.irq_moderation_ms = 5,		\
 		.irq = (ev_ring) + 1,		\
 		.priority = 1,			\
@@ -127,9 +127,9 @@ struct mhi_pci_dev_info {
 		.offload_channel = false,	\
 	}
 
-#define MHI_EVENT_CONFIG_HW_DATA(ev_ring, ch_num) \
+#define MHI_EVENT_CONFIG_HW_DATA(ev_ring, el_count, ch_num) \
 	{					\
-		.num_elements = 2048,		\
+		.num_elements = el_count,	\
 		.irq_moderation_ms = 1,		\
 		.irq = (ev_ring) + 1,		\
 		.priority = 1,			\
@@ -156,12 +156,12 @@ static const struct mhi_channel_config modem_qcom_v1_mhi_channels[] = {
 
 static struct mhi_event_config modem_qcom_v1_mhi_events[] = {
 	/* first ring is control+data ring */
-	MHI_EVENT_CONFIG_CTRL(0),
+	MHI_EVENT_CONFIG_CTRL(0, 64),
 	/* DIAG dedicated event ring */
-	MHI_EVENT_CONFIG_DATA(1),
+	MHI_EVENT_CONFIG_DATA(1, 128),
 	/* Hardware channels request dedicated hardware event rings */
-	MHI_EVENT_CONFIG_HW_DATA(2, 100),
-	MHI_EVENT_CONFIG_HW_DATA(3, 101)
+	MHI_EVENT_CONFIG_HW_DATA(2, 1024, 100),
+	MHI_EVENT_CONFIG_HW_DATA(3, 2048, 101)
 };
